PHP Monitor 开源项目安装与使用指南
本指南旨在帮助您了解并使用 nicoverbruggen/phpmon,这是一个轻量级的原生Mac菜单栏应用程序,用于管理多个PHP安装、定位配置文件,并且能够与Laravel Valet互动。下面是关于项目关键部分的详细介绍,包括目录结构、启动与配置相关的内容。
1. 项目目录结构及介绍
项目根目录主要结构如下:
.gitignore
: 控制哪些文件或目录不被Git版本控制系统跟踪。DEVELOPER.md
: 为开发人员提供的额外详细信息,可能包括开发环境设置、测试指南等。LICENSE
: 许可证文件,说明软件使用的授权条款。README.md
: 项目的主要文档,包含快速入门指南和重要信息。SECURITY.md
: 关于软件安全性的指导和报告漏洞的流程。swiftlint.yml
: SwiftLint的配置文件,用于代码风格的一致性检查。phpmon
: 应用程序的核心代码目录。phpmon-updater
: 更新器相关代码,负责应用的自动更新逻辑。assets
: 可能包含图标、图片等静态资源。docs
: 文档资料,可能会有更深入的技术说明或开发者文档。integrations
: 如果项目支持与其他服务或工具集成,相关代码或配置可能会放在这里。tests
: 单元测试和功能测试代码,确保应用的关键部分按预期工作。
2. 项目的启动文件介绍
在 phpmon
目录内或者相关的Xcode项目中,通常有一个主入口点。对于Swift项目,这通常是AppDelegate.swift
。由于具体文件未直接提供,我们假设该应用通过Xcode编译,并以Main.storyboard
或指定界面控制器作为启动界面。对于终端用户来说,启动过程不需要直接操作这些文件,而是通过安装后的应用图标来运行。
3. 项目的配置文件介绍
-
对于PHP Monitor本身,配置似乎不是直接由最终用户编辑的一个突出部分。配置可能是应用内部管理的,特别是在第一次运行时或通过应用内的设置进行调整。例如,PHP版本路径、监控选项或与Valet的交互设置等,可能存储在应用沙盒内的偏好设置里。
-
用户若需自定义配置,通常会依赖于系统级别的设置(比如修改PHP路径或环境变量),或者应用内置的任何配置界面。对于开发者贡献或自定义构建,开发者需查看
DEVELOPER.md
或源码中的注释以找到特定的配置选项和文件位置。
请注意,由于直接访问和编辑这些配置文件可能不适合日常用户,用户应遵循应用内提示或查阅开发者文档来进行配置更改。
此文档基于提供的GitHub仓库信息构建,实际使用时,详情可能有所不同。建议参照最新版本的官方文档或仓库中的最新信息进行操作。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考